Ida Josephine Dyer was born in 1931 in Rupert, Minidoka County, Idaho, United States of America, the child of Clyde Sater Dyer And Pearl S Dyer. In 1935, Ida Josephine Dyer resided in Rural, Washington, Arkansas. In 1940, Ida Josephine Dyer resided in Center, Washington, Arkansas, USA. Ida Josephine Dyer married Donald Ray Wygle, Loren Joel Smyth. Ida Josephine Dyer passed away in 2003 in Junction City, Lane County, Oregon, United States of America.
